ATX Financial Planning LLC Purchases New Holdings in Abbott Laboratories $ABT

ATX Financial Planning LLC acquired a new position in shares of Abbott Laboratories (NYSE:ABTFree Report) during the 4th quarter, according to its most recent 13F filing with the SEC. The fund acquired 10,709 shares of the healthcare product maker’s stock, valued at approximately $1,342,000.

Abbott Laboratories Price Performance

ABT opened at $88.48 on Friday. The company has a quick ratio of 1.01, a current ratio of 1.39 and a debt-to-equity ratio of 0.56. The company’s 50-day moving average price is $90.39 and its 200 day moving average price is $106.73. Abbott Laboratories has a fifty-two week low of $81.97 and a fifty-two week high of $139.06. The firm has a market cap of $154.12 billion, a price-to-earnings ratio of 24.78, a price-to-earnings-growth ratio of 1.52 and a beta of 0.63.

Abbott Laboratories (NYSE:ABTGet Free Report) last issued its earnings results on Thursday, April 16th. The healthcare product maker reported $1.15 EPS for the quarter, beating analysts’ consensus estimates of $1.14 by $0.01. The company had revenue of $11.16 billion during the quarter, compared to the consensus estimate of $10.99 billion. Abbott Laboratories had a return on equity of 17.62% and a net margin of 13.90%.Abbott Laboratories’s quarterly revenue was up 7.8% compared to the same quarter last year. During the same period in the previous year, the firm posted $1.09 earnings per share. Abbott Laboratories has set its FY 2026 guidance at 5.380-5.580 EPS and its Q2 2026 guidance at 1.250-1.310 EPS. As a group, sell-side analysts expect that Abbott Laboratories will post 5.48 earnings per share for the current year.

Abbott Laboratories Dividend Announcement

The business also recently disclosed a quarterly dividend, which will be paid on Monday, August 17th. Investors of record on Wednesday, July 15th will be paid a dividend of $0.63 per share. This represents a $2.52 dividend on an annualized basis and a yield of 2.8%. The ex-dividend date is Wednesday, July 15th. Abbott Laboratories’s dividend payout ratio is presently 70.59%.

Abbott Laboratories Profile

Abbott Laboratories is a global healthcare company headquartered in Abbott Park, Illinois, that develops, manufactures and markets a broad portfolio of medical products and services. Founded in 1888, Abbott operates through multiple business areas that focus on diagnostics, medical devices, nutritionals and established pharmaceuticals. The company supplies hospitals, clinics, laboratories, retailers and direct-to-consumer channels with products intended to diagnose, treat and manage a wide range of health conditions.

In diagnostics, Abbott provides laboratory and point-of-care testing platforms and assays used to detect infectious diseases, chronic conditions and biomarkers; its Alinity family of instruments and rapid-test solutions are examples of this capability.
